You will need to have a bachelor's in aerospace engineering from an accredited university to be able to become an engineer. The curriculum includes coursework in aerodynamics, structural mechanics, and computational modeling. You will also complete a senior design capstone project. Many bachelor's programs in aerospace engineering offer an accelerated path to graduate study or direct access to a doctoral program. What does an electrical engineer do?
They create power systems for human use.
They are responsible to design, build, test, install, maintain, and repair all types of electrical equipment used by industry, government and residential customers.
They plan and direct installation, as well as coordination of activities by other trades like architects, plumbers, and contractors.
Electrical engineers design, install, and maintain electronic circuits, devices, and components that convert electricity in to usable forms.
